📄 frmpopmenu.frm
字号:
VERSION 5.00
Begin VB.Form frmPopmenu
Caption = "弹出式菜单"
ClientHeight = 3195
ClientLeft = 60
ClientTop = 345
ClientWidth = 4680
LinkTopic = "Form1"
ScaleHeight = 3195
ScaleWidth = 4680
StartUpPosition = 3 '窗口缺省
WindowState = 2 'Maximized
Begin VB.Menu popmenu
Caption = "popmenu"
Visible = 0 'False
Begin VB.Menu Popmenu_Addline
Caption = "添加线路信息"
End
Begin VB.Menu Popmenu_Changeline
Caption = "修改线路信息"
End
Begin VB.Menu Popmenu_Delline
Caption = "删除线路信息"
End
End
Begin VB.Menu popmenu2
Caption = "popmenu2"
Visible = 0 'False
Begin VB.Menu Popmenu_AddPlat
Caption = "添加站点信息"
End
Begin VB.Menu Popmenu_ChangePlat
Caption = "修改站点信息"
End
Begin VB.Menu Popmenu_DelPlat
Caption = "删除站点信息"
End
End
Begin VB.Menu popmenu3
Caption = "popmenu3"
Visible = 0 'False
Begin VB.Menu Popmenu_AddPlace
Caption = "添加地点信息"
End
Begin VB.Menu Popmenu_ChangePlace
Caption = "修改地点信息"
End
Begin VB.Menu Popmenu_DelPlace
Caption = "删除地点信息"
End
End
End
Attribute VB_Name = "frmPopmenu"
Attribute VB_GlobalNameSpace = False
Attribute VB_Creatable = False
Attribute VB_PredeclaredId = True
Attribute VB_Exposed = False
Private Sub Popmenu_AddLine_Click() '添加线路
ichangeFlag = 1
frmAddLine.Show
frmAddLine.ZOrder 0
End Sub
Private Sub Popmenu_ChangeLine_Click() '修改线路信息
If frmmanageLine.MSFlexGrid1.Rows > 1 Then
strPublicSQL = "select * from LineInfo where [NO]="
strPublicSQL = strPublicSQL & Trim(frmmanageLine.MSFlexGrid1.TextMatrix( _
frmmanageLine.MSFlexGrid1.Row, 0))
frmChangeLine.Show
frmChangeLine.ZOrder 0
Else
Exit Sub
End If
End Sub
Private Sub Popmenu_Delline_Click() '删除线路信息
Dim sql As String
Dim rs As New ADODB.Recordset
sql = "delete from LineInfo where [NO]=" & Trim(frmmanageLine.MSFlexGrid1.TextMatrix( _
frmmanageLine.MSFlexGrid1.Row, 0))
If MsgBox("真的要删除这条记录么?", vbOKCancel + vbExclamation, "提示!") = vbOK _
Then
Call TransactSQL(sql, "shujuku")
MsgBox "记录已经删除!", vbOKOnly + vbExclamation, "提示!"
sql = "select * from LineInfo order by [NO]"
Call frmmanageLine.showTopic '显示结果
Call frmmanageLine.ShowData(sql)
End If
End Sub
Private Sub Popmenu_AddPlat_Click() '添加站点
ichangeFlag = 1
frmAddPlat.Show
frmAddPlat.ZOrder 0
End Sub
Private Sub Popmenu_ChangePlat_Click() '修改站点信息
If frmmanagePlat.MSFlexGrid1.Rows > 1 Then
strPublicSQL = "select * from PlatInfo where PlatNO="
strPublicSQL = strPublicSQL & Trim(frmmanagePlat.MSFlexGrid1.TextMatrix( _
frmmanagePlat.MSFlexGrid1.Row, 0))
frmChangePlat.Show
frmChangePlat.ZOrder 0
Else
Exit Sub
End If
End Sub
Private Sub Popmenu_DelPlat_Click() '删除站点信息
Dim sql As String
Dim rs As New ADODB.Recordset
sql = "delete from PlatInfo where PlatNO=" & Trim(frmmanagePlat.MSFlexGrid1.TextMatrix( _
frmmanagePlat.MSFlexGrid1.Row, 0))
If MsgBox("真的要删除这条记录么?", vbOKCancel + vbExclamation, "提示!") = vbOK _
Then
Call TransactSQL(sql, "shujuku")
MsgBox "记录已经删除!", vbOKOnly + vbExclamation, "提示!"
sql = "select * from PlatInfo order by PlatNO"
Call frmmanagePlat.showTopic '显示结果
Call frmmanagePlat.ShowData(sql)
End If
End Sub
Private Sub Popmenu_AddPlace_Click() '添加地点
ichangeFlag = 1
frmAddPlace.Show
frmAddPlace.ZOrder 0
End Sub
Private Sub Popmenu_ChangePlace_Click() '修改地点信息
If frmmanagePlat.MSFlexGrid1.Rows > 1 Then
strPublicSQL = "select * from PlaceInfo where PlaceNO="
strPublicSQL = strPublicSQL & Trim(frmmanagePlace.MSFlexGrid1.TextMatrix( _
frmmanagePlace.MSFlexGrid1.Row, 0))
frmChangePlace.Show
frmChangePlace.ZOrder 0
Else
Exit Sub
End If
End Sub
Private Sub Popmenu_DelPlace_Click() '删除地点信息
Dim sql As String
Dim rs As New ADODB.Recordset
sql = "delete from PlaceInfo where PlaceNO=" & Trim(frmmanagePlace.MSFlexGrid1.TextMatrix( _
frmmanagePlace.MSFlexGrid1.Row, 0))
If MsgBox("真的要删除这条记录么?", vbOKCancel + vbExclamation, "提示!") = vbOK _
Then
Call TransactSQL(sql, "shujuku")
MsgBox "记录已经删除!", vbOKOnly + vbExclamation, "提示!"
sql = "select * from PlaceInfo order by PlaceNO"
Call frmmanagePlace.showTopic '显示结果
Call frmmanagePlace.ShowData(sql)
End If
End Sub
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-